Stepping into the Role: Becoming a Server Host for Minecraft PE

Minecraft Pocket Edition (PE) brings the beloved sandbox game to mobile devices, allowing players to enjoy the immersive world of Minecraft on the go. While the game offers a rich single-player experience, stepping into the role of a server host for Minecraft PE can unlock a whole new level of creativity and community interaction. In this article, we will explore the process of becoming a server host for Minecraft PE and the rewards and responsibilities that come with it.

Why Host a Minecraft PE Server?

Hosting a Minecraft PE server allows you to create a shared space where players can come together, collaborate, and enjoy multiplayer experiences. As a server host, you have the power to shape the server's rules, gameplay modes, and overall atmosphere. Here are a few reasons why hosting a Minecraft PE server can be a rewarding experience:

  1. Community Building: Hosting a Minecraft PE server provides a platform for building a community of like-minded players who share a passion for Minecraft. You can create a welcoming and inclusive environment where players can connect, collaborate, and form friendships. Building a community around your server fosters a sense of belonging and can lead to lasting relationships.

  2. Creative Expression: As a server host, you have the freedom to customize your server's settings, themes, and gameplay modes. You can unleash your creativity by designing unique worlds, creating custom mini-games, or curating special events for your players. Hosting a Minecraft PE server allows you to express your creativity and share it with others.

  3. Learning and Growth: Managing a Minecraft PE server can be a valuable learning experience. It provides an opportunity to develop skills in server administration, problem-solving, community management, and leadership. As you navigate the challenges that come with hosting a server, you can grow both personally and professionally.

  4. Personal Satisfaction: Hosting a Minecraft PE server can be personally fulfilling. Seeing players enjoy the experiences you've created, witnessing their creativity flourish, and fostering a positive community can bring a sense of accomplishment and satisfaction. Creating a space where players can have fun and make memories is a rewarding endeavor.

Steps to Become a Server Host for Minecraft PE:

  1. Determine Your Hosting Method: Decide whether you want to host the server on your own device or use a dedicated hosting service. Hosting on your own device may be suitable for a small number of players, while dedicated hosting services offer more stability and scalability for larger communities.

  2. Choose a Hosting Service: If you opt for a dedicated hosting service, research and select a reliable and reputable hosting provider that offers Minecraft PE server hosting. Consider factors such as server performance, customer support, pricing, and available features.

  3. Configure Your Server: Set up your server by configuring settings such as the server name, game mode, difficulty, and player limit. Decide whether you want a survival, creative, or custom game mode, and customize other aspects to suit your preferences and the desired gameplay experience.

  4. Set Server Rules and Moderation: Establish clear server rules to ensure a positive and respectful environment for all players. Decide on guidelines regarding behavior, language, griefing, and cheating. Designate moderators or staff members who can enforce the rules and address any issues that may arise.

  5. Promote Your Server: Spread the word about your Minecraft PE server to attract players. Utilize social media platforms, Minecraft community forums, and word-of-mouth to reach potential players. Create an appealing server description that highlights unique features or gameplay modes to entice new players to join.

  6. Maintain and Update Your Server: Regularly monitor and maintain your server to ensure smooth gameplay and address any technical issues. Stay updated with Minecraft PE updates and release new features, maps, or events to keep the gameplay fresh and engaging.

  7. Engage with the Community: Interact with your server's community by engaging in conversations, addressing player feedback, and organizing special events or competitions. Foster a friendly and inclusive atmosphere where players feel valued and heard.

Hosting a Minecraft PE server requires dedication, time, and effort. It's important to regularly communicate with your player base, address concerns promptly, and provide a positive and enjoyable environment for all. As a server host, you have the opportunity to shape the experiences of your players and create a community that thrives on creativity, collaboration, and fun.

Becoming a server host for Minecraft PE opens doors to a world of creativity, community building, and personal growth. Through hosting, you can create a space where players can come together, express their creativity, and enjoy multiplayer adventures. By following the steps outlined above, you can embark on a fulfilling journey as a server host, providing an engaging and enjoyable Minecraft PE experience for players around the world.
